Loyola Maryland is a men's basketball team that represents Loyola University Maryland in Baltimore, Maryland. The team competes in the Patriot League and has a rich history of success, including a trip to the NCAA Tournament in 2012. The team is known for its strong defense and disciplined play, as well as its ability to execute in clutch situations. The Loyola Maryland Greyhounds are led by head coach Tavaras Hardy, who has instilled a culture of hard work and dedication in his players. The team's home court is Reitz Arena, which provides an intimate and energetic atmosphere for fans to cheer on their beloved Greyhounds. With a talented roster and a winning tradition, Loyola Maryland is a force to be reckoned with in the Patriot League and beyond.
